Drugs In Clinical Trials

Important Notice: The Forum does not endorse any medical product or therapy. ALL medications and supplements should be taken ONLY under the supervision of a physician, due to the possibility of side-effects, drug interactions, etc.

Name: ST101
Other Names: spiro[imidazo[1,2-a]pyridine-3,2-indan]-2(3H)-one, ZSET1446
Therapy Types: Oral, small molecule
Development Status: investigational in U.S.
FDA Phase: Inactive
Role in Alzheimer's Disease: ZSET1446/ST101 is an azaindolizinone derivative compound that has demonstrated cognitive enhancer activity in numerous rodent models of cognitive impairment, improving methamphetamine-induced memory impairment in rats (Ito et al 2007), olfactory bulbectomy-induced cognitive deficits in mice (Han et al 2008). In Alzheimer’s Disease-related preclinical tests, ZSET1446 improves cognitive function impaired by ICV Abeta(1-40) infusion or scopolamine-induced memory deficits, and stimulates acetylcholine release (Yamaguchi et al 2006). Chronic administration of ZSET1446 improved neurogenesis impairment following olfactory bulbectomy in mice (Shioda et al 2010), stimulating ERK and PI3K/Akt pathways in new dentate gyrus neurons.
Companies: Sonexa Therapeutics, Inc.
Notes: For clinical trials of ST101 for Alzheimer's disease on clinicaltrials.gov see ST101 trials.
